President-elect Donald Trump said on Dec. 17 that he has nominated former NFL player and Georgia Senate candidate Herschel Walker to serve as the U.S. ambassador to the Bahamas.

In a statement on Truth Social, the incoming president said he believes Walker, 62, is the ideal candidate for the role because he has “spent decades serving as an ambassador to our nation’s youth, our men and women in the military, and athletes at home and abroad.”
